⑦
STOP button
This stops the recorder.
⑧
PLAY/PAUSE button/indicator
This starts and pauses recorder playback. The indicator shows the playback status as follows.
Status Explanation
Lit green The recorder is playing back.
Blinking green Playback is paused.
⑨
REC button/indicator
This puts the recorder in recording standby. The indicator shows the recording status as follows.
Status Explanation
Lit red The recorder is recording or in recording standby.
Blinking red Recording is paused.
⑩
REW button
Press to move to the previous mark.
If no mark is set, this moves to the beginning.
Press this button when at the beginning to move to the previous project.
Press and hold to search backward. (The longer you press, the faster the speed becomes.)
⑪
FF button
Press to move to the next mark.
If it is the last mark, this moves to the end of the file. Press this button again to move to the next project.
Press and hold to search forward. (The longer you press, the faster the speed becomes.)
⑫
OVER DUB button/indicator
Status Explanation
Lit (ON) Record by overwriting into the current project folder.
Unlit (OFF) Create a new project folder and make a new recording.
